  • Can I bring PETS or SERVICE ANIMALS to the Aquarium Restaurant?

    Service animals are welcome in most areas of the Aquarium Restaurant at no additional charge. Employees will not take responsibility or provide care for any service animal. Aquarium Restaurant reserves the right to remove any service animal that poses a threat to the safety and/or welfare of the Aquarium’s guests, employees, or property.


    Guests with service animals, please check in at the hostess stand before entering the Aquarium Restaurant. Service animals must be restrained on a leash or harness at all times.


    Service Animals are defined by the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) as a dog or miniature horse that has been individually trained to do work or perform tasks for an individual with a disability. The task(s) performed by the service animal must be directly related to the person’s disability. Untrained/service animals “in training” are not considered service animals. Emotional support, comfort, or companion animals are NOT service animals and therefore are not permitted on property and are not protected by law.
